WHAT ?
THE PROGRAM
VISUAL ARTS
3 day workshop comprising painting, drawing, art making, water color etc with a professional(s) from the respective fields
Special Visiting Professional for Career Counseling
CREATIVE WRITING
3 day workshop comprising fiction, poetry, essay, memoir, short story, script, plots, plays etc with professional(s) from the respective fields
Special Visiting Professional for Career Counseling
CULINARY ARTS
3 day demonstration comprising local and other tastes culinary displays by respective professionals
Special Visiting Professional for Career Counseling
POTTERY, SCULPTURE, ORIGAMI, COLOR FACTORY, BODY ART, CONTEMPORARY DANCE, COMMUNICATIONS workshop
3 days of FUN with respective professionals.
THEMATIC GRAFFITI (Peace, Unity & Progress) on last day by all participants, with permission from authority.
Stalls displaying LOCAL HANDICRAFTS and ART for sale and exposure.
Eateries/ Culinary displays
Performances by local MUSICians
Closing day performance by a renowned name or a PLAY by a school/college
WHY ?
For children and youth to re channel their talent into positive initiatives, personal development & empowerment, direction and confidence building activities.
To provide positive art related training opportunities aimed at developing self-esteem and community ownership through highlighting the creative talents and the positive content of the Darjeeling Hills.
To incorporate art into community bonding activities for all genders, races, ethnicities etc – for peace and harmony
To provide exposure for aspiring artists derived from outside professional counseling to broaden individual artistic vision esp. for career aspirants in the Arts and provide opportunities to explore their own creative abilities.
To provide a place to display and showcase local art and talent to a wider audience market.
To lend an introductory platform for the annual program of PROD which comprises regular workshops, programs and guidance facilities conducted for children, youth and aspiring artists by professionals and teachers from the respective fields.
Fun, frolic, laughter
WHEN ?
· May 24th 2008 through May 26th 2008
· Venue : Darjeeling Gymkhana
· 3 Days
